Understanding DEI in Corporate Settings

Before diving into how event planning can support DEI initiatives, it’s important to Event Planning Services what DEI means in a corporate context:

  • Diversity refers to the presence of differences within a given setting, including race, gender, age, sexual orientation, and more.
  • Equity involves ensuring fair treatment, access, and opportunities for all individuals, while also striving to identify and eliminate barriers that have historically led to unequal outcomes.
  • Inclusion is about creating environments in which any individual or group can feel welcomed, respected, supported, and valued.

Incorporating DEI into corporate events not only reflects a company’s values but also enhances employee engagement and satisfaction.

The Role of Corporate Event Planning Services

Corporate event planning services play a crucial role in executing events that align with DEI initiatives. Here are several ways these services can contribute:

1. Diverse Representation in Planning

One of the first steps in aligning corporate events with DEI initiatives is ensuring diverse representation in the planning process. This means involving individuals from various backgrounds, experiences, and perspectives in the event planning team. By doing so, the planning team can better understand the needs and preferences of a diverse audience, leading to more inclusive events.

2. Inclusive Event Themes and Content

When planning corporate events, it’s essential to choose themes and content that resonate with a diverse audience. This can include:

  • Keynote Speakers: Selecting speakers from various backgrounds can provide different perspectives and insights, enriching the event experience.
  • Workshops and Panels: Offering sessions that address DEI topics, such as unconscious bias, cultural competency, and allyship, can foster meaningful discussions and learning opportunities.

3. Accessible Venues and Formats

Accessibility is a critical component of inclusion. Corporate event planning services should prioritize venues that are physically accessible to all attendees. This includes considerations such as wheelchair access, appropriate seating arrangements, and accessible restrooms. Additionally, offering virtual attendance options can ensure that those who cannot attend in person still have the opportunity to participate.

4. Catering to Diverse Dietary Needs

Food is an integral part of any event, and catering should reflect the diversity of the attendees. Corporate event planners should work with catering services to provide a variety of food options that accommodate different dietary restrictions and preferences, including vegetarian, vegan, gluten-free, and culturally specific dishes. This attention to detail demonstrates respect for the diverse backgrounds of attendees.

5. Creating Safe Spaces for Dialogue

Corporate events can serve as platforms for open dialogue about DEI issues. Event planners can create safe spaces for discussions, allowing attendees to share their experiences and perspectives. This can be facilitated through breakout sessions, roundtable discussions, or informal networking opportunities. Providing a supportive environment encourages honest conversations and fosters a sense of community.

Measuring the Impact of DEI-Focused Events

To ensure that corporate events are effectively supporting DEI initiatives, it’s important to measure their impact. Here are some strategies for evaluation:

1. Attendee Feedback

Collecting feedback from attendees can provide valuable insights into their experiences. Surveys can be distributed after the event to gauge participants’ perceptions of inclusivity, engagement, and overall satisfaction. This feedback can inform future event planning and help identify areas for improvement.

2. Participation Metrics

Analyzing participation metrics can help assess the effectiveness of DEI initiatives. Tracking attendance from diverse groups and monitoring engagement levels can provide insights into how well the event resonated with various audiences.

3. Long-Term Impact

Consider the long-term impact of the event on the organization’s DEI goals. Are attendees more engaged in DEI initiatives following the event? Are there observable changes in workplace culture or employee satisfaction? Evaluating these factors can help determine the overall success of the event in promoting DEI.
